Znaleziono 14 wyników

autor: JohnJames
17 lip 2021, 06:46
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

mk77 pisze:Sensorless homing - jak to działa w sapphire pro ? warto ? czy tylko dodatkowe problemy ?
Nie znam się to się wypowiem :mrgreen:
Dla mnie sama idea walenia karetką w ogranicznik jest dziwna, więc nawet nie mam ochoty próbować.
Zapewne trzeba się trochę napracować żeby to działało w miarę przewidywalnie, bo albo zatrzyma się gdzieś po środku, albo się nie zatrzyma... Ludzie z tym walczą i ponoć niektórym działa ;)

U siebie zamieniłem endstopy z NO na NC bo raz po pracach serwisowych nie kontaktował jeden czujnik i doświadczenie nie było miłe, więc pewnie stąd ta awersja :DD
autor: JohnJames
08 kwie 2021, 11:08
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

mk77 pisze:Użyłem dystrybucji le3tspeak bo dopiero co zaczynam przygodę z drukarką a to był w zasadzie samograj.
Też tak zrobiłem na początku :)
I dopóki działa, nie ma problemu. Ale jeśli są jakieś problemy, to IMHO lepiej jest przejść na wersję jak najbliżej głównego developmentu.
mk77 pisze:Oczywiście nie wykluczam skorzystania z innej dystrybucji, choćby z tej co polecasz waniliowej.
"waniliowa" w sensie niemodyfikowana. Repozytorium projektu Marlina jest tu: https://github.com/MarlinFirmware/Marlin
Mam to repozytorium sforkowane u siebie z wrzuconą swoją konfiguracją. Ponieważ pliki konfiguracyjne le3speak są nieco inne, niż stockowe, warto poświęcić dwie godziny i przepisać swoje ustawienia do oryginalnego pliku. Potem, przy aktualizacjach do nowej wersji, lepiej będzie się tym zarządzać.
mk77 pisze:Rozumiem że ten link co wrzuciłeś kilka postów wyżej https://github.com/bkiziuk/Marlin/tree/bugfix-2.0.x to jest Twoja obecna konfiguracja tej dystrybucji waniliowej ?
Tak. Trzymanie tego na github'ie jako fork ma swoje zalety.
Wszelkie zmiany w konfiguracji możesz śledzić. Aktualizację do nowej wersji przeprowadzasz pobierając uaktualnienia z upstreamu.
No i masz backup całego kodu i konfiguracji w sytuacji, kiedy dysk w pececie odmówi współpracy ;)
autor: JohnJames
08 kwie 2021, 08:00
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

mk77 pisze:Na razie to zostawiam jako standalone i do tematu wrócę niebawem.
le3tspeak rozwija własny fork Marlina pod kątem drukarek TT.
On jest fajny na początek, bo ma konfiguracje przygotowane pod tą drukarkę - wystarczy powłączać i w zasadzie nie trzeba się doktoryzować z konfiguracji.
Z drugiej strony większość używa waniliowego Marlina i być może w obszarze, z którym walczysz, są w nim jakieś różnice.
No, a jak masz swoją konfigurację, w której czasami robisz jakieś zmiany, warto jednak wiedzieć, co i po co jest ustawione ;)
A to prowadzi do rozważań, czy nie lepiej przesiąść się na wersję waniliową :mrgreen:
autor: JohnJames
06 kwie 2021, 10:33
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

mk77 pisze:Konfiguracja dla 2209_standalone przeszła. Firmware się skompilował i działa w drukarce. Błędami wali przy włączeniu uart.
Możesz zobaczyć, jak jest u mnie https://github.com/bkiziuk/Marlin/tree/bugfix-2.0.x
Ostatnio kompilowane dwa dni temu, na wersji bugfix-2.0.x.
autor: JohnJames
06 kwie 2021, 08:50
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

Równie dobrze przekornie można stwierdzić, że tak :mrgreen:
To zależy od wybranego rozwiązania.
Ja mam zrobione na sprzętowym serialu zgodnie z rysunkiem w dokumentacji TMC2209 - https://www.trinamic.com/fileadmin/asse ... t_V103.pdf, rysunek 4.1, lewy obrazek.
Kolega arkomania.pl ma, jak widzę, na programowym, w którym jeden pin procka służy do komunikacji z jednym stepstickiem.
Teraz już dokładnie nie pamiętam, ale jak szukałem informacji na ten temat - zostałem przytłoczony różnymi rozbieżnymi informacjami na temat sposobu realizacji komunikacji ze stepstickami. Nie znalazłem usystematyzowanego opisu, natomiast bardzo dużo różnych wykonań.
Sytuację komplikuje fakt, że ludzie mają generalnie różne płyty i wykonania stepsticków (różnie wyprowadzone TX/RX, różnie zezworowane podstawki), do których trzeba dostosować połączenia. Dlatego IMHO trzeba przede wszystkim rozumieć, co się robi w odniesieniu do sprzętu, który się posiada.
autor: JohnJames
17 paź 2020, 19:40
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

dziobu pisze:
JohnJames pisze:Jeszcze jedno. Żeby 4 stepsticki działały na pojedynczym UART, to tenże UART musi być sprzętowo wspierany w procku - bo wówczas pozwala na ustawienie adresu na magistrali.
Co to jest ustawianie adresu na magistrali przez sprzętowy UART i dlaczego programowy na to nie pozwala?
Masz rację, trochę źle się wyraziłem. To kwestia drivera i wydajności procka.
Natomiast miałem niejasne wrażenie, po przerzuceniu różnych poradników na temat podłączania UARTa, że emulacja programowa nie pozwala na wybór adresu albo też, że to raczej słabo działa. Jeśli się mylę, uprzejmie proszę o wyprowadzenie z błędu.
autor: JohnJames
17 paź 2020, 16:05
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

Jeszcze jedno. Żeby 4 stepsticki działały na pojedynczym UART, to tenże UART musi być sprzętowo wspierany w procku - bo wówczas pozwala na ustawienie adresu na magistrali. STM32F1 ma ich pięć. Jeden jest używany do wyświetlacza, drugi do USB, trzeci do WiFi, a czwarty i piąty - jeśli dobrze widzę - do SD.
Możesz podłączyć stepstick do dowolnych innych pinów, ale wówczas UART jest robiony programowo i obsługuje tylko jeden stepstick. Nie wiem, czy w tym trybie może też działać dwukierunkowo.
autor: JohnJames
17 paź 2020, 14:20
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

Polo232323 pisze: Juz sie chyba poddaję nwm co dalej z tym zrobić jesli mogłbyś mi podesłać skompilowanego marlina to było by to dla mnie duże wsparcie. Mam wszystko podpięte wg twojego posta i nic to nie daje .Ciągle wyskakuje mi takie coś?
Primo, wygląda na to, że masz inne stepsticki niż moje. Sądząc z obrazka - Fysetc v3.0.
A one maja inaczej wyprowadzone TX/RX, o czym wspomniałem tu: https://reprapy.pl/viewtopic.php?f=8&t= ... 30#p112225

Secundo, masz podłączony UART zupełnie gdzie indziej, więc moja kompilacja nic Ci nie da, bo i tak działać nie będzie.

Tertio, ponieważ stepsticki są inne, trzeba sprawdzić na schemacie płyty, co jest na płycie na tych pinach, na których masz na stepstickach wyprowadzone RX/TX, bo ja widzę, że jest to noga 11 i 12 podstawki, które są zezworowane razem. A zgodnie z dokumentacją TMC2209 oraz schematem stepsticków, pomiędzy TX i RX na procku ma być rezyskor 1kOhm. O tym też wspomniałem tu: https://reprapy.pl/viewtopic.php?f=8&t= ... 30#p112208

Tu nie ma niestety jednego słusznego standardu podłączenia i różni się to w zależności od płyty, stepsticków, oraz wybranego portu UART (sprzętowy czy programowy i na których pinach). I do tego wszystkiego trzeba indywidualnie dostosować jeszcze konfigurację Marlin'a.
autor: JohnJames
12 paź 2020, 07:18
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

Rnext pisze:U mnie po wyjęciu filamentu wyłącza/gasi ekran a po włożeniu jest tak jak po resecie/włączeniu drukarki. Czyli gotowość systemu.
Masz błąd w okablowaniu. Zwierasz czujnikiem linię 5V do masy.
Trzeba albo odwrócić kabel (rada z internetu - nie testowałem - sprawdziłem przy podłączaniu czy jest dobrze), albo zamienić piny w jednej z wtyczek.
autor: JohnJames
11 paź 2020, 17:41
Forum: Kalibracja, problemy
Temat: TMC2209 problem uart. MKS robin nano
Odpowiedzi: 113
Odsłony: 37164

Re: TMC2209 problem uart. MKS robin nano

Polo232323 pisze: A jak ustawiłeś zworki ?
Jeśli cofniesz się kilka postów, całkiem obszernie się tam wyprodukowałem.

Wróć do „TMC2209 problem uart. MKS robin nano”